PSG will “need” Kimpembe, says former world champion

Last updated: 8 February 2025 at 16:56
By Flavien Casini Published 8 February 2025
3 Min Read
PSG will “need” Kimpembe, says former world champion
@Anthony Dibon/Icon Sport
SHARE

Presnel Kimpembe, 29-year-old defender for Paris Saint-Germain and the French National Team, was back in action on Tuesday evening in the 0-2 win over Le Mans in the 8th final of the Coupe de France 2024-2025. His return after 2 years out of the game has raised the question: what role can he expect to play in Paris from now on? Blaise Matuidi, former PSG midfielder and 2018 world champion with Les Bleus, is very confident about his ex-teammate. He explains to Le Parisien.

Matuidi “has a strong character, above average.”

“I’m more than happy to have him back. It’s great to be back competing with the club that means so much to him. He’s someone who puts a lot of heart into things. He has great qualities.

When you’re away for a long time, there’s always frustration. But he has a strong character, above average. He’s got a mind of steel. He’s a leader. He’s going to prove that he’s still capable of helping the team and performing well.

Matuidi “La Force Presko will be back”.

I’m sure PSG will need the grinta he can exude when he’s in top form. It’s really important to be able to rely on players like him, who have come through the youth ranks. I have every confidence in him. He’ll be back to his best, and the team needs him. He’s a great addition to the team. The Presko Force will be back.“

The former midfielder spent a long time with Kimpembe at PSG and in the French national team, so he knows him well and has confidence in him for a reason. He knows that Presko will give his all and that his determination is contagious for his team-mates.

However, that’s not really what we’re wondering about. The defender’s fighting spirit has always been admirable, and his perseverance in returning to PSG after an absence of almost 2 years is remarkable. Except that it’s not necessarily enough to play a real role on the pitch this season.

Kimpembe will undoubtedly provide support in training and in the dressing room, with his experience and desire to pass on. We’re less sure that he’ll be able to return to a level that will enable him to be a great asset in Ligue 1 clashes or in the Champions League. Even if we hope he does, of course. It’s a huge challenge for the defender in the face of the competition and the high standards that have been set at PSG.
